Network Diversity
The variety and range of connections an individual or organization has, including different industries, backgrounds, and expertise.
Symbolic Ties
Relationships or connections that are not based on formal agreements but rather on shared values, trust, or identity.
Board of Advisors
A group of external experts who provide strategic advice to the management of a company, but who do not have any governance authority.
Personal Liability
The legal responsibility of an individual to repay debt or answer for other obligations out of their personal assets, not just the assets of their business or investment.
